- The National Aeronautics and Space Administration (NASA)/Goddard Space FlightCenter is releasing a Draft Cooperative Agreement Notice (CAN) No. NNG10331134C for theEstablishment of Centers of Excellence in the Solar-Heliospheric and Solar-Planetarysciences. The primary focus is the establishment of centers of excellence forcollaborative research in Solar-Heliospheric and Solar-Planetary sciences between NASA,and Educational, or Not for Profit Science organizations, and Non-profits with 501 (c)(3) status, other than institutions of higher education.The potential sources are encouraged to submit questions or comments on or beforeSeptember 10, 2010, via email to the point of contact designated below. Additionally,you are further encouraged to submit questions or comments as they arise, in lieu ofsubmitting them on the last day. The schedule for the review and selection of proposalsfor this CAN is as follows: Final CAN Issuance, Fall 2010, Proposals due +60 days, Awardannouncement/Agreement signed, First Quarter CY 2011.
